In providing a regional breakdown of the data, we used four regional groupings, i.e. Atlantic, Quebec, Ontario and West. In addition, we have separately presented data for respondents whose organization spanned two or more regions. These will likely include larger businesses, and larger national unions which represent workers in more than one region.
In examining the results, the data is divided by region thus the sample size in individual regions becomes quite small. The results suggest that there are differences - perhaps significant ones - in business and labour attitudes in different regions. Results also suggest there would be considerable value in exploring these regional differences more deeply.
